Yağ Cami
Historical mosque in Adana, Turkey
Yağ Cami is a historical mosque located in the old town of Adana, Turkey.[1] The structure was originally built as the Surp Hagop Armenian Apostolic Church at the second half of the 13th century during the Armenian Kingdom of Cilicia. It was converted into a mosque in c.1380 by the Ramazanoğlu Bey Şihabeddin Ahmed,[2] just after taking over the city. It is the oldest mosque in the city and later on formed part of the külliye that also includes a madrasah.
